What is the edge length of 216 cube unit?
To find the edge length of a cube given its volume, you take the cube root of the volume. For a cube with a volume of 216 cubic units, the edge length is calculated as follows: ( \text{Edge length} = \sqrt[3]{216} = 6 ) units. Therefore, the edge length of the cube is 6 units.

What divides the heart in two parts?
The heart is divided into two main parts—right and left—by a muscular wall called the septum. The septum separates the heart's right side, which pumps deoxygenated blood to the lungs, from the left side, which pumps oxygenated blood to the rest of the body. This division ensures efficient circulation and prevents the mixing of oxygen-rich and oxygen-poor blood.
Which regular polygon has a minimum rotation of 45 degrees?
A regular octagon is the polygon that has a minimum rotation of 45 degrees. This is because an octagon has eight equal sides and angles, and rotating it by 45 degrees (which is 360 degrees divided by 8) aligns it with another vertex. Thus, the angles of rotation for an octagon are multiples of 45 degrees.

Do the interior angles of a hexagon add up to 720 degrees?
Yes, the interior angles of a hexagon do add up to 720 degrees. This can be calculated using the formula for the sum of interior angles of a polygon, which is ((n - 2) \times 180) degrees, where (n) is the number of sides. For a hexagon, (n = 6), so the sum is ((6 - 2) \times 180 = 4 \times 180 = 720) degrees.
What is the transformation called if it preserves the shape and size of an object?
The transformation that preserves the shape and size of an object is called a "rigid transformation" or "isometry." This type of transformation includes translations, rotations, and reflections, ensuring that distances and angles remain unchanged. Consequently, the object's overall geometry remains intact throughout the transformation process.
What is the length of the diagonal of a 10 cm by 15 cm rectangle?
To find the length of the diagonal of a rectangle, you can use the Pythagorean theorem. For a rectangle with width ( w = 10 ) cm and height ( h = 15 ) cm, the diagonal ( d ) is calculated as ( d = \sqrt{w^2 + h^2} = \sqrt{10^2 + 15^2} = \sqrt{100 + 225} = \sqrt{325} ). Thus, the length of the diagonal is approximately 18.03 cm.
How d I draw a pair of adjacent supplementary angle so that one angle has the given measure?
To draw a pair of adjacent supplementary angles, start by drawing a straight line, which will serve as one side of both angles. Choose one angle measure, and use a protractor to measure that angle from the line, marking its vertex. Then, since supplementary angles add up to 180 degrees, subtract the given angle measure from 180 to find the measure of the second angle. From the vertex, use the protractor to measure and mark the second angle adjacent to the first, ensuring they share a common side along the straight line.

What is the sum of exterior angles of a 34 sided shape?
The sum of the exterior angles of any polygon, regardless of the number of sides, is always 360 degrees. Therefore, for a 34-sided shape, the sum of the exterior angles is also 360 degrees. This holds true for any polygon, whether it is regular or irregular.

How many diagonals does a convext decagon have?
A convex decagon has 10 sides. The formula for calculating the number of diagonals in a polygon is ( \frac{n(n-3)}{2} ), where ( n ) is the number of sides. For a decagon, substituting ( n = 10 ) gives ( \frac{10(10-3)}{2} = \frac{10 \times 7}{2} = 35 ). Therefore, a convex decagon has 35 diagonals.
